In the landscape of historic Massachusetts towns, Easton is one of the oldest. Just 40 minutes south of Boston, Easton is a sleepy suburb with a few pockets of old Massachusetts still standing. Oakes Ames Memorial Hall is the posterchild of Easton. Built in the late 19th century, it was a gift intended to be used as the Town Hall, but today it’s used as a popular venue and meeting space.
Most of Easton is largely residential, with long, tree-lined roads connecting the more populous parts of the area with each other. A concise downtown area offers up chic new shops and restaurants like The Farmer’s Daughter. You’ll find some of Massachusetts most highly-rated schools in Easton, making the area popular with families.
The town comes together every year for a number of events, including the Lighting of the Rockery. The Fall River Expressway is the closest thoroughfare near Easton, making a commute up to Boston relatively simple.
